Thinking of Buying in New Town?

New Town is a popular, established suburb close to Hobart, with a large number of older homes and properties that have undergone varying levels of renovation.
While many homes appear solid, I regularly see issues that are not obvious during open inspections.
Common issues in New Town include:
• Subfloor moisture and ventilation problems in older homes
• Movement-related cracking in brickwork and plaster
• Roofing, flashing, and guttering defects
• Outdated wiring or switchboard concerns
• Bathroom waterproofing issues, especially in renovated homes
• Timber decay or weathering due to age and maintenance
A proper building inspection helps uncover these issues before you commit.

Local Building Knowledge in New Town

New Town has a high concentration of older homes, many of which have been renovated or extended over time.
It’s common to see a mix of original construction and newer additions, which can sometimes lead to inconsistencies in workmanship, structure, or compliance.
In this area, I frequently identify:
• Settlement cracking in older masonry structures
• Subfloor dampness and inadequate ventilation
• Roofing issues on ageing properties
• Renovation work that may not meet current standards
• Decks, extensions, or additions requiring closer assessment
• General wear and deterioration associated with older homes
Each inspection is carried out with these local factors in mind.
